Transaction 8996eb86d96f9506229abd3148830980bd6d7f576540e538baa19c3822106781

1 Input
2 Outputs
  • 8996eb86d96f9506229abd3148830980bd6d7f576540e538baa19c3822106781:0
  • value  3025489
    address  3A76gMSD7bqRmZV6aq3dRVqDhc8NQ6sggV
  • 8996eb86d96f9506229abd3148830980bd6d7f576540e538baa19c3822106781:1
  • value  13023073
    address  31rW1kSVTbPYr5qx28gUhXbXb9vYba3gst